Pine Ridge Classic Golf Course is an 18-hole public golf course located in Mt. Airy, North Carolina. Established in 1987 and designed by architect Larry Taylor, the course offers golfers a municipal playing experience in the scenic North Carolina landscape. The facility includes a driving range for practice and warm-up sessions. While limited course details are available, the venue provides an accessible golfing option for local and visiting players. One notable feature mentioned by a previous player was a tree positioned near the 7th tee, which potentially impacts the tee shot line of sight.
